Stormio Boost

(Image credit: Nespresso)

Nespresso Stormio Boost pod

(Image credit: Nespresso)

The Stormio Boost capsule has an intensity level of 8 and comes as a 230ml serving, so you’re getting a lot from just a small pod. When I first tasted it, I noticed it was rather bitter with a lot of woody notes coming through. I added a dash of milk and a sweetener which toned it down quite a bit, but it’s a perfect choice for anyone who really likes the strong taste of coffee.

A sleeve of 10 is available on theNespresso websitefor £7.90.

Melozio Boost

(Image credit: Nespresso)

Nespresso Melozio Boost pod

(Image credit: Nespresso)

Just like the Stormio Boost, theMelozio Boostalso contains 20% more caffeine than a regular capsule. However, its intensity level is a little less, coming in at a 6. This makes it less bitter than the Stormio Boost and I found it was a lot smoother to drink. It also has a much sweeter taste which made it a great option to have as a bit of an afternoon boost, perfect for beating thatdreaded energy slump.

Just like the Melozio Boost, it comes as a 230ml serving. There’s also aregular Meloziocapsule available as well as acaffeine free version- perfect if you like the taste of the blend but prefer something a little less strong.

A sleeve of 10 is available on theNespresso websitefor £7.90.

Vivida B12

(Image credit: Nespresso)

Nespresso Vivida B12

(Image credit: Nespresso)

TheVivida B12capsule is the only pod in the range that has added vitamins. Vitamin B12 is known to support to the normal functioning of the immune system and there’s enough of it in one cup of Vivida to give you 25% of the recommended daily value. Whilst it’s not recommended to have four daily cups in order to reach that allowance, it’s nice to know that I was contributing to my overall wellbeing just through a cup or two of coffee. Who would’ve thought?!

The Vivida B12 also has a sweet taste with warming biscuity notes. As it was a 230ml serving, I just had to add a small amount of milk and it was perfect. The temperature has significantly dropped over the past few days, so having a Vivida B12 coffee in the mornings has been the perfect way to start the day.

A sleeve of 10 is available on theNespresso websitefor £7.90.

Ginseng Delight

(Image credit: Nespresso)

Nespresso Ginseng Delight

(Image credit: Nespresso)

Whilst I really enjoyed the other capsules in the Coffee+ range, I’m going to have to say that theGinseng Delightis probably my favourite. It’s made from a smooth blend of Latin American Arabica and Ugandan Robusta, as well as a botanical ingredient called Panax Ginseng Extract. Over 2000 years ago, Panax Ginseng was praised in China as the ‘king of herbs’, known to exert healing properties.

The blend has delicious caramel and biscuit cake notes, combined with the distinct taste of ginseng and subtle earthy notes. From my first cup, I absolutely loved the taste and have firmly made my way through the sleeve ever since. Unlike the other capsules, it comes as an 80ml serving. This means you can either add hot water and a dash of milk for the perfect cup, or you can use amilk frotherfor something special. If you like a sweeter coffee that’s nice and rounded, then the Ginseng Delight capsules are for you.

A sleeve of 10 is available on theNespresso websitefor £7.90.

Nespresso is on a mission to ensure as many people as possible recycle their used capsules, and it is now easier than ever thanks to a new partnership between Nespresso and Royal Mail. Anyone can book aRoyal Mail doorstep collectionfor their used Nespresso capsules, or there is the option of dropping them off at any of Royal Mail’s 14,000+ drop-of locations across the UK.
